web-dev-qa-db-ja.com

LinuxのみでWindows 10 USBインストールドライブを作成する

udiskとは、SATA-to-USB3.0のプラスチックボックスに2.5インチHDDを配置したを意味しますケーブル

私はLinux(Arch&Ubuntu)にかなり慣れています(専門家ではなく、日常的にしか使用していません)が、Windowsの初心者です。ときどき、私のWindowsが、なんらかの愚かながらも回復不可能な操作を行った後、動作しなくなった。しなければならない:

  1. Windows 10 isoイメージファイルをダウンロード
  2. 他の人からWindowsコンピュータを借りる。
  3. そのコンピューターにUltraisoをインストールします。
  4. Ultraisoおよびisoファイルを使用してWindows 10インストールudiskを作成します。
  5. Udiskで起動します。
  6. Windows 10を修復/再インストールします。

コンピュータを借りたり、追加のudiskを準備したりするのにうんざりしています。 WindowsなしでLinuxのみでWindowsインストールudiskを作成する方法はありますか

許容できない解決策:

  • dd if=[XXX.iso] of=/dev/sdX-udiskは起動できなくなり、何度も試行されます
  • Install Ultraiso onWindows VMcreate a virtual disk, use Ultraiso to flash iso to virtual disk, binary dump virtual disk to my udisk-トラブルが多すぎる

可能な解決策:

  • ISOLINUX/GRUB2/etcを手動で設定します。 udiskで、isoを抽出します(もしそうなら、完全なチュートリアルが高く評価されています)
  • ...

ありがとうございます。

7
Darren Ng

現在これを行うための最良の方法は woeusb を使用することです

woeusb  --target-filesystem NTFS --device path/to/windows.iso /dev/sdX

それを好む人のためのGUIもあります。

19

いくつか検索を行ったところ、完全なスクリプト windows2usb が見つかりました。

WoeusbはUEFIをサポートしていないため、このツールはBIOSおよびUEFI(rufusドライバーを使用)、FAT32、およびNTFSをサポートします。

1
recolic